Factors to consider when choosing the right broadband speed for your home in Rodsley

 

The answer to this question can depend on a number of factors including your online activities, the number of people in your home, and even the devices in use. Let us break it down together.

Web Activities

The initial stage is typically to understand what precisely you use your broadband connection at your Rodsley house for.

If you are mainly browsing the internet, receiving and sending emails, and engaging in social media, a standard broadband package providing speeds ranging from 10 to 25 Mbps should meet your needs.

If you’re interested in watching videos or listening to music, you may consider increasing that connection speed. For streaming HD movies, a speed of around 15-25 Mbps per stream is recommended. If you’re into ultra HD or 4K streaming, then you’re looking at a minimum of 25 megabits per second for your property in Rodsley.

For those who love gaming, speed is of utmost importance. Typically, a recommended speed of 50-75 Mbps is sufficient for an optimal gaming experience. However, if you engage in playing high-demand games, a higher speed might be necessary.

Number of Internet Users in your Rodsley property

The second factor to take into account is the number of people in your Rodsley home that are using your internet connection.

If it’s just you in the home, the mentioned speeds previously mentioned ought to be sufficient. However, for each extra person at your house in Rodsley who’ll be online simultaneously, you need to increase your speed accordingly.

For instance, if you have a family of four all streaming, gaming, and browsing, you’ll require a connection speed that can handle that heavy usage, in the range of 100 Mbps or more.

Devices in your Rodsley house

Lastly, think about devices you are using within your home in Rodsley. Smartphones and tablets typically do not require as much broadband speed compared to laptops and desktop computers.

Furthermore, if you have smart home devices like thermostats, lighting, or CCTV cameras, they also will require faster speed.

Types of broadband connections that may be available in Rodsley

 

DSL (Digital Subscriber Line)

DSL internet connections use phone lines to receive and send data, providing a internet connection using your existing phone networks in Rodsley. Although DSL offers quicker broadband speeds compared to dial-up, it’s performance and speed tend to degrade in quality over longer distances.

Cable

Cable broadband utilises coaxial cables to deliver internet services. It provides higher speeds and higher bandwidth compared to DSL, as the cable infrastructure is designed for data.

Cable broadband is commonly available in urban and suburban areas and may also be available at your address in Rodsley. The most commonly available cable Internet provider is Virgin Media.

Fibre-optic broadband

Fibre-optic broadband is the most reliable and fastest type of broadband connection.

It broadband thin strands of glass or plastic to send and receive data as pulses of light, offering incredibly high speeds and low latency. Fibre-optic connections are slowly growing, mainly in metropolitan areas, and provide great performance for bandwidth hunry online activites.

Satellite broadband

Satellite broadband connects households to the internet through satellites encircling the Earth.

It’s It’s available in remote or rural areas where conventional wired links are not be feasible. Satellite broadband delivers coverage across a wide geographical area, however it may have greater latency and slower speeds compared to other broadband types.
